AI Summary
- Amends Agriculture and Markets Law to require dog control officers, peace officers, police officers, and animal shelters/humane societies to promptly inspect each seized dog and provide immediate veterinary care, parasite control, and vaccinations to relieve pain and suffering
- Mandates that seized dogs receive proper shelter and food, and have continuous access to potable, non-frozen water while in the possession of authorities or shelter facilities
- Extends the same inspection, veterinary care, vaccination, shelter, food, and water requirements to lost, stray, or homeless animals taken into possession by officers, societies, pounds, or municipal shelters
- Takes effect thirty days after becoming law
Legislative Description
Requires improvement in shelter care for dogs; requires the prompt inspection of each dog following seizure; provides that potable non-frozen water shall be made accessible to each dog.
